This Miso Mayo will change your life. After this recipe, you will always have it in the fridge. It's a quick and simple recipe that's full of umami flavor.
This mayonnaise can be used on sandwiches, as a dipping sauce for fried snack, as a base for different dressings, and even as a complement on a steak tartare.
The white wine vinegar can be replaced with apple cider vinegar.

Miso Mayo
Kuba Blogowski
Add 4 egg yolks to a tall jug
Add 1tbsp of miso and 2tbsp of white wine vinegar
Add 3tbsp of soy sauce. Mix with a hand blender until homogeneous
Add 2/3cup of sunflower oil in a thin stream while beating until emulsified. The Miso Mayo is ready
